Summary:
The 06110 zip code area in West Hartford, Connecticut is home to two elementary schools: Charter Oak International Academy and Wolcott School. While both schools serve students from pre-kindergarten through 5th grade, Wolcott School stands out as the higher-performing institution, consistently outpacing Charter Oak International Academy and the West Hartford School District averages on standardized test scores.
Wolcott School ranks in the top 38% of Connecticut elementary schools, while Charter Oak International Academy falls in the bottom 40%. This performance gap is evident across all grade levels and subject areas, with Wolcott School's students demonstrating significantly higher proficiency rates in English Language Arts, Mathematics, and Science. Additionally, Wolcott School serves a more economically advantaged student population, with a lower percentage of free/reduced lunch recipients compared to Charter Oak International Academy.
The data suggests that the higher per-student spending at Wolcott School ($19,550) compared to Charter Oak International Academy ($15,562) may contribute to the school's stronger academic outcomes. However, factors such as teacher quality, curriculum, and school leadership likely play a more significant role in driving the performance differences between the two institutions. Understanding these underlying factors could provide valuable insights for improving educational outcomes across the West Hartford School District.
